What is the name of the first Sumerian writing system which used wedge shaped styluses s on clay tablets?

The first Sumerian writing system is called cuneiform. It was developed around 3200 BCE and utilized wedge-shaped marks made by pressing styluses into soft clay tablets. This writing system was initially used for record-keeping and evolved to encompass various languages and literary forms over time.


What is Sumerian writing consisting of hundreds of wedge shaped marks cut into damp clay tablets with sharp edges reed?

Sumerian writing is known as cuneiform, which consists of hundreds of wedge-shaped marks made by pressing a reed stylus into damp clay tablets. This writing system originated in ancient Mesopotamia around 3200 BCE and was used for various purposes, including record-keeping, literature, and administrative documentation. The term "cuneiform" itself means "wedge-shaped," reflecting the distinctive shapes of the characters. Over time, it evolved to represent different languages and cultures in the region.

What was cuneiform written with?

Cuneiform was written on clay tablets with a stylus which was usually a reed, flattened on one end to make the impression in the clay. The impressions were wedge-shaped. Cuneiform means "wedge-shaped".

Why is the Sumerian writing called cuneiform?

The ancient Sumerian writing system is known as "cuneiform" from the Latin cuneus ("wedge "), because the symbols are wedge-shaped, and marked into clay tablets with a stylus. The characters of cuneiform writing were originally pictorial, but because of the method of writing, they evolved into collections of wedge-shaped marks with little visual indication to their origins.

What is a cuneiform made out of?

Cuneiform was typically made by pressing a stylus into clay, creating wedge-shaped markings. Clay tablets were then dried or fired to preserve the writing. The clay was the primary material used for cuneiform writing in ancient Mesopotamia.
